String Quartet No. 21 (Mozart)

It has acquired the nickname The Violet, used for example in Hans Keller's chapter of The Mozart Companion.

There are four movements: The quartet was written for (and in Mozart's private 'thematic catalogue') was described as being dedicated to the King of Prussia,[1] Friedrich Wilhelm II, an amateur cellist.

Mozart and his friend Karl Lichnowsky met the king in Potsdam in April 1789.

Mozart played before the king in Berlin on 26 May 1789, then returned to Vienna.
